Title: GRAPHENE OXIDE-MXENE NANOCOMPOSITE FOR ROOM TEMPERATURE HYDROGEN STORAGE AND PREPARATION THEREOF
Publication Date: 16-05-2025 File Date: 09-11-2023
Inventor(s): Pradip Kumar; Shankar Ghotia; Shiv Singh; Asokan Pappu; Avanish Kumar Srivastava
IPC Classification: C01B 32/921, B82Y 30/00, B82Y 40/00, C08K 3/04, C01B 32/184, C01B 32/194, H01G 11/24
Abstract:
The present invention relates to Graphene Oxide-MXene nanocomposite material and the process for preparation thereof. More particularly, the present invention  describes Graphene Oxide-MXene composite and process for preparation by simple chemical method and potential uses for hydrogen storage technologies. The  developed Graphene Oxide-MXene nanocomposite material demonstrates exceptional features, including a room temperature (25?5?C) uptake of gravimetric hydrogen  up to 5.08 wt.% under normal pressure GO-Ti3C2Tx MXene nanocomposite material has a huge potential to attain the targets set by the US DOE for gravimetric  hydrogen storage. Further, the present invention provides a potential solution to current research challenges and paves the way for future advancements in solid-state  materials-based fuel cell devices and technologies.
